Option
Description
NOTE:
This option is relevant only when the Integrated NIC control in the System
Configuration group is set to Enable with Cloud Desktop.
Server IP Address
This option specifies the primary static IP address of the Cloud Desktop Server with
which the client software communicates. The default Server IP Address is
255.255.255.255
NOTE:
This option is relevant only when the Integrated NIC control in the System
Configuration group is set to Enable with Cloud Desktop.
Server Port
This option specifies the primary IP port of the Cloud Desktop with which the client
software communicates. The default Server Port value is
06910
.
NOTE:
This option is relevant only when the Integrated NIC control in the System
Configuration group is set to Enable with Cloud Desktop.
Client Address Method
This option specifies how the client obtains its IP address. The options are:
Static IP
- Uses the static IP address
DHCP
- Obtains IP addresses using DHCP. This option is selected by default
NOTE:
This option is relevant only when the Integrated NIC control in the System
Configuration group is set to Enable with Cloud Desktop.
Client IP Address
This option specifies the static IP address of the client. The default IP Address is
255.255.255.255
NOTE:
This option is relevant only when the Integrated NIC control in the System
Configuration group is set to Enable with Cloud Desktop.
Client SubnetMask
This option specifies the subnet mask IP address of the client. The default IP Address
is
255.255.255.255
NOTE:
This option is relevant only when the Integrated NIC control in the System
Configuration group is set to Enable with Cloud Desktop.
Client Gateway
This option specifies the gateway IP address of the client. The default IP Address is
255.255.255.255
NOTE:
This option is relevant only when the Integrated NIC control in the System
Configuration group is set to Enable with Cloud Desktop.
Advanced
This option allows you to enable the Verbose Mode.
Verbose Mode
Table 13. Image Server
License Status
Displays the EasyConnect Embedded license status.
